Paying twice for users to collaborate

It would appear that Figma was designed to make collaboration easy, however it seems very expensive to collaborate.

We engage a design company who use Figma. We bought Figma licences for our users. The design company has Figma licenses for their users.

We want to be able to collaborate on a file (not just leave comments, but work with the designers to update copy and make other adjustments). Apparently we have to pay again for all our users. If we work with two design agencies in this way, we need to pay three times for our users.

Surely Figma is designed to make collaboration easier?

